Port Adelaide’s Piper Window and Cheyenne Hammond will return to the Power’s side this Sunday after overcoming injuries that sidelined them since Rounds 1 and 4 respectively. 

Window has been named on the interchange, pulling on the black, white and teal for just the second time this season after recovering from an ankle injury, while Hammond has been named in the backline following her successful rehabilitation from a finger fracture. 

After an impressive seven-tackle debut against Geelong, Lauren Young will line up for her second AFLW game in the forward line, alongside draftee Jasmine Sowden, who returns this week, as well as Justine Mules-Robinson, Gemma Houghton and Abbey Dowrick. 

Draftee Lily Paterson also returns to the side, named on the interchange for her fourth AFLW appearance. 

The last time Port Adelaide faced St Kilda was in Round 8 of the 2024 season, with the Power securing a 15-point win. 

The Power will meet the Saints from 12:35pm ACST on Sunday, with the match broadcast live on Fox Footy, Kayo and Channel 7 from 12:30pm.
